Carlsbad 5000 ’22 Race Recap
5K pacing is tough. Run out too fast early and you have nothing left in the tank to push and sacrifice ruining your overall time. Run too conservative early on because you’re worrying about blowing up and you have too much time to make up to hit your goal. I went into training for this race with a big lofty goal.
